Personal Narrative - Brennan Clayton

The picture that I used was by Calvin Fletcher and the tile of the picture is Wash Day in Brigham City and I thought represented a Utopia. It brought a thought of happiness to my mind. The old woman hanging her clothing out on the line looked so happy even in the snow and cold. She looked like she didn’t have a care in the world and was absolutely loving her life.
In Fahrenheit 451 they wanted the society to be a perfect society or a Utopia. They tried in a way that messed everything up and it created something bad. A world where no one can read books or know the true meanings of things.
